Poland Seeks to Host ESA Center, Invests in Space Sector
Polish Minister of Finance and Economy, Andrzej Domański, announced that Poland aims to host a European Space Agency (ESA) center. He emphasized that investment in the space sector is crucial for the country's strategic autonomy and economic growth.
